The drug-resistant cell line KB-C2 with high expression of ABCB1 was established by stepwise screening of the parental human epidermoid carcinoma cell line KB-3-1 in increasing concentrations of colchicine and cultured in the medium with 2 mg/mL of colchicine (Akiyama et al., 1985). We had used the paired cell lines for P-gp reversal study since 1993 as KB-C2 drug selected MDR subline is a good model for P-gp associated study. Therefore, we used KB-C2 and its parental cell line KB-3-1 in this study. HEK293/pcDNA3.1 and HEK293/ABCB1 cells lines were established by selection with 2 mg/mL G418 (Enzo Life Sciences, Farmingdale, NY) after transfecting HEK293 with the empty pcDNA3.1 vector or the vector containing full length ABCB1 DNA, respectively (Zhang et al., 2015). All the cell lines were cultured in DMEM containing 1% penicillin/streptomycin and 10% FBS at 37°C with 5% CO2. All drug-resistant cell lines were cultured in drug-free medium for more than 2 weeks prior to their use.
